**Job Description**
**AECOM is seeking an Environmental Scientist/Geologist to support our Minnesota Environmental Remediation teams (Minnesota/Wisconsin).** We are seeking candidates who will be able to immediately contribute to the successful delivery of projects and promote growth in existing and new markets, specifically related to remediation system operation work, with opportunities to support additional projects. This full-time position within our Environmental group will assist in coordinating and conducting environmental projects related to Environmental compliance and supporting groundwater treatment operations. The ideal candidate will be able to demonstrate project experience, require a strong focus on health and safety, be detailed orientated, excellent written and verbal communication skills, ability to work independently, and will be capable of working collaboratively in a high-performance team.
**Job Summary/Responsibilities:**
+ Utilizes advanced scientific principles, theories, practices and existing technologies develop technical solutions to complex problems.
+ Interprets and records data, conducts analyses, compares findings to relevant studies and local, provincial and national regulations to ensure compliance. Work is performed with minimal direction.
+ Exercises considerable latitude in determining technical objectives of assignment. Responsible for advanced duties and activities in their specialized functional area.
+ Assists in the resolution of conflicting technical information and unsuitability of standard procedures.
+ Performing complex assignments often requires the development of unique solutions to problems.
+ May oversee the work of less experienced scientists or operators.
+ May operate and support groundwater treatment systems to meet required discharge limits during routine influent and treatment conditions outlined in the associated Permits.
+ May operate and support groundwater ozone treatment in a safe and professional manner, including maintaining required training and certifications including e- RAILSAFE, Contractor Orientation, and Roadway Worker Protection, or other client required training.
+ Confirming proper operation and testing of treatment systems after repairs, maintenance, or cleaning.
+ Participating in internal and client required calls, and conferences.
+ Perform inspections utilizing client required inspection system.
+ Coordinating and/or assisting with repairs, maintenance, and cleaning.
+ Read, understand, and follow published test methods and standard operating procedures, including company and client specific programs.
+ Produce accurate and complete documentation of operation, inspections, and compliance according to standard operating procedures.
+ Show initiative in maintaining and repairing equipment, ordering, and organizing supplies and maintaining work area.
+ Effectively work both independently and in a team environment.
+ Effectively communicate with site representatives regarding schedules and task requirements.
+ Keep well organized files and documentation to meet regulatory requirements.
+ May gather and maintain specified records of scientific data for supervisor, including but not limited to environmental sampling, operations and maintenance and inspections at client sites.
+ Other activities may include assisting with calculations, setting up and operating equipment, inspecting equipment and installations for compliance with specifications and maintaining proper project documentation.
+ Collects and enters data and applies technical principles and theories under supervision.
+ Participate in other environment-related projects and tasks as required, and support operations at other client facilities under the direction of staff, as necessary.
+ Performs standardized or prescribed assignments involving a sequence of related operations.
+ Conducts a variety of standardized tests and may set up and operate standard laboratory testing equipment of moderate complexity.
+ Records test data and provide observation and interpretations of it.
+ Knowledge of environmental regulations, practices, and procedures; recognizes differences or changes that would indicate the need for attention. Receives and maintains required safety training including OSHA 40-hr HAZWOPER Training with annual 8-hr refresher, 30-hr OSHA Training, client-specific training, and regulatory specific training.
+ Position requires availability for on-call duty. Employees who work on-call are expected to be available to work outside on their normal work schedule, including weekends, on short notice.
+ Position will perform tasks that may require moving and working in outdoor environments with uneven terrain and variable environmental conditions including heat, cold, dusts, dryness, noise, moisture, vibration, and chemicals to perform daily walk-throughs, inspection of worksite, environmental sampling, and operations and maintenance tasks.
+ Position may require repetitive bending/stooping, to perform environmental sampling tasks.
+ Position requires ability to operate office computer and field tablet to enter data tracking requirements.
+ Position may require lifting, carrying, and loading equipment weighing up to 50 lbs. such as sample coolers and pumps without assistance and up to 75lbs. with assistance.
+ On occasion position may require working with arms above shoulder level and using ladders.
+ Position will include wearing associated personal protective equipment, including but not limited to gloves, safety glasses/goggles, safety shoes/boots, hard hat, and hearing protection.
**Qualifications**
**Minimum Requirements:**
+ BA/BS + 2 years of relevant experience or demonstrated equivalency of experience and/or education and experience.
+ Due to the nature of work, US citizenship is required.
+ As a condition of employment, selected candidates must pass a Motor Vehicle Records review and a substance abuse test.
+ Must pass a State and Federal criminal history/security background check.
+ Candidate must be able to meet medical clearance requirements of an OSHA (HAZWOPER) medical surveillance physical exam.
**Preferred Qualification**
+ 2+ years working on large site investigation and remediation projects.
**Additional Information**
Offered compensation will be based on location and individual qualifications. The expected range is $52,000.00 - $70,000.00.
